区块链技术自诞生以来,凭借其去中心化、不可篡改和透明化的特性,广泛应用于金融交易领域。然而,随着市场和技术的发展,区块链金融交易的安全性问题也日益凸显。本文将对当前区块链金融交易安全性面临的主要问题进行深入分析,并提出相应的对策建议。
1. 区块链金融交易的基本特征
区块链金融交易是以区块链技术为基础进行的交易行为,其基本特征包括去中心化、不可篡改性和全程可追溯性。去中心化意味着不再依赖第三方机构进行监管和验证,而是由网络中所有参与者共同维护交易的真实性和完整性。这种特性减少了交易成本,提高了效率,但也带来了新的安全风险。
2. 区块链金融交易安全性问题概述
尽管区块链技术为金融交易提供了新的解决方案,但安全性问题仍然十分突出。主要包括以下几个方面:
- 智能合约漏洞:智能合约作为自动执行交易的程序,是区块链金融交易的重要组成部分。然而,合约中的编程错误或设计缺陷可能导致资金损失或合约执行不当。
- 51%攻击:在一些小型区块链网络中,如果某个实体控制了超过51%的计算能力,就可以对区块链进行攻击,进行双重支付等恶意行为。
- 用户私钥的安全:用户的私钥是控制区块链资产的关键,一旦私钥泄露,攻击者可以轻易转移用户的财产。
- 交易所安全性:许多用户通过中心化的交易所进行交易,这种集中管理模式容易成为黑客的攻击目标,导致用户资产风险。
3. 智能合约漏洞的影响及防范措施
智能合约是区块链金融交易的核心,然而其潜在的漏洞可能导致严重的经济损失。例如,2016年发生的“DAO事件”,由于智能合约漏洞,黑客成功从DAO基金中盗取了价值5000万美元的以太币。
为了防范智能合约漏洞,可以采取以下措施:
- 代码审计:在部署智能合约之前,进行全面的代码审计,确保合约逻辑无误,并修复已知漏洞。
- 测试和验证:利用完善的测试工具和模拟环境进行系统的合约测试,确保在各种情境下均能正确无误地执行。
- 升级和补丁机制:设计合理的合约升级机制,一旦发现漏洞可以及时进行修复,降低风险。
4. 51%攻击的案例分析及防范措施
51%攻击通常发生在算力较低的区块链网络,比如一些小型加密货币。在这种攻击中,攻击者通过控制超过51%的算力,获取对网络的控制权,从而可以进行双重支付等恶意操作。
防止51%攻击的方法包括:
- 增加网络算力:通过吸引更多的矿工参与,从而提高网络的算力,增加51%攻击的难度。
- 引入权益证明机制:转向权益证明(Proof of Stake)等共识机制,降低单一实体控制网络的可能性。
- 监测和预警机制:建立完善的监测系统,实时检测算力变化异常,及时发出警报。
5. 用户私钥安全管理
用户私钥是区块链资产的唯一控制方式,一旦泄露,资产将面临被盗风险。2018年,著名的加密货币交易所Bitfinex因用户私钥泄露,导致数千万美元的资产被盗。
用户可以通过以下方式提高私钥安全性:
- 离线存储私钥:将私钥尽可能存储在离线设备上,如硬件钱包,避免网络攻击的风险。
- 定期更换私钥:定期更换私钥并更新相关信息,降低被攻击的风险。
- 使用多重签名技术:利用多重签名技术,确保在进行交易时需要多个私钥的确认,增加安全性。
6. 交易所的安全性挑战与对策
中心化交易所由于其便捷性,成为普通用户进行交易的主要渠道。然而,由于其集中的本质,交易所面临着巨大的安全性挑战。近年来,多个交易所遭到黑客攻击,用户资产遭受重创。
为了提高交易所的安全性,交易所应采取以下措施:
- 强化网络安全防护:投入更多资源进行网络安全防护,采用防火墙、入侵检测等安全措施,抵御外部攻击。
- 用户资产冷存储:将大部分用户资产存储在冷钱包中,减少在线处理时的风险。
- 透明的资产审计:定期进行资产审计,向用户公开审计结果,增加用户对交易所的信任。
潜在相关问题讨论
区块链金融交易的监管机制如何建立?
随着区块链金融交易市场的不断发展,如何建立有效的监管机制成为一个重要课题。监管可以有效遏制市场的风险和欺诈行为,维护金融稳定。
建立监管机制需要考虑以下几方面:
- 法规制定:制定法律法规,为区块链金融业务运营提供法律依据,明确参与者的权利和义务。
- 合规标准:建立针对区块链金融交易的合规标准,对交易所、项目方及投资者进行全面的监管。
- 监管科技的应用:借助大数据、人工智能等新技术,提高监管的效率和精准度。
如何在区块链网络中提高用户的信任度?
提升用户在区块链网络中的信任度是促进区块链应用广泛的关键。用户的信任来自于对网络安全、透明度和信誉的认可。
为提高用户的信任度,可以采取以下措施:
- 透明的信息披露机制:定期公开项目进展、财务状态等信息,增强用户对项目的理解和信任。
- 社区治理:鼓励用户参与项目的治理和决策过程,提高用户对项目的参与感和信任感。
- 声誉系统建设:建立用户声誉系统,记录用户的交易行为和资产安全情况,增强用户对平台的信任。
区块链金融交易对传统金融机构的影响
区块链金融交易的兴起对传统金融机构产生了深远的影响,主要体现在效率、监管、竞争等多个维度。
传统金融机构需要考虑以下方面:
- 提高效率:面对区块链带来的高效交易,传统金融机构需提升服务效率,缩短交易时间。
- 发展创新业务:探索区块链技术在金融业务中的应用,开发新产品,吸引用户。
- 适应监管环境变化:及时调整合规策略,以应对区块链带来的新风险和挑战。
如何评估区块链项目的安全性?
区块链项目的安全性评估对于投资者决策至关重要。评估项目安全性可从多个维度入手。
包括:
- 技术白皮书审核:仔细阅读项目的技术白皮书,关注其技术实现和安全措施。
- 团队背景调查:了解项目团队的背景和经验,判断其能力和信誉。
- 经济模型评估:分析项目的经济模型,判断其可持续性和安全性。
未来区块链金融交易的发展趋势
区块链金融交易的发展快速且多样化,未来可能出现以下趋势:
- 规范化与合规化:随着监管的完善,区块链金融交易将朝向合规化发展,建立起行业标准和规则。
- 跨链技术发展:跨链技术将促进不同区块链之间的交互与合作,提高资产的流动性。
- 金融产品创新:更多基于区块链的金融产品将涌现,满足用户多样化的需求。
综上所述,区块链金融交易安全性问题多方面且复杂,然而通过技术手段和制度建设的结合,可以有效降低风险,保护用户资产安全。在技术快速发展的今天,安全依然是区块链技术应用过程中不可忽视的重要环节。希望本文的探讨能为相关从业者和研究者提供一些思路和参考。
leave a reply